| Figured there hasn't been a question in ages.
Q: If you were to chain heal a banish target first would the bounces also be enhanced by 75%? | |

| In terms of coding, no. Lets say the first heal would be for 1000, and it hits the Banished target. The next bounce would not be increased by banish. The pseudocode could look something like this. X = 1000 Y = X Z = 0 W = Bounces
Select target for heal Heal target for X If target has banish debuff, heal for Z (Z = X + 75% of X)
Repeat W times { Y = Y * 0.5 Z = 0 Target closest friendly unit to original target Heal that person for Y If target has banish debuff, heal for Z (Z = Y + 75% of Y) }

| without all that math above, here is an easier way to figure out how banish works:
"Banish changes the targets armor type, which is what increases the spell damage done"
If I have reduced armor, that is the reason I am taking more spell damage (or in this case healing) it does not change the spell being cast. | |
